APIs (application programming interfaces) enable one application (like an ecommerce platform) to expose the services (like order management, catalogue content, pricing information and customer data) to other applications. A well-defined API is an adhesive that connects data together and allows authorized machines or applications to access the data easily.
Similarly, ecommerce APIs facilitate communications among applications on ecommerce platforms. These APIs are ideally divided into various subcategories like ecommerce payment, platform, inventory, marketing, and marketplace. Each of these subcategories has a different role to play. For example,
- Ecommerce platform APIs help businesses build their online shop (think of Shopify or WooCommerce).
- Payment APIs add purchasing functionality to a website and simplify the process of purchasing goods. It can even integrate with other APIs to provide customers with a seamless buying experience (think of PayPal)
Ecommerce APIs enable businesses to adjust to their customers’ needs smoothly and quickly without investing a lot of resources and time into building or revamping the website. They also help businesses automate, manage, and coordinate their ecommerce operations. The time saved on these facets of running a business can be invested in creating a viable customer experience.
List of high-in-demand Ecommerce APIs with Robust Designs:
WooCommerce is one of the most secure and widely preferred ecommerce platforms. It is an open-source API that plugs into WordPress and transforms the website into a full-fledged ecommerce store. Other benefits that it offers are:
- You can change your subscription type easily
- You can add and remove products from your shop quickly, filter through orders, and retrieve item details
- It is compatible with Amazon, Magento and Shopify
Magento’s ecommerce API features a broad array of capabilities designed to streamline the process of running an online business. It enables the developers to work with multiple resources, such as orders, customers, products, or categories.
The API supports JSON and XML with four HTTP methods – PUT, POST, GET and DELETE and allows you to build your customized ecommerce website.
Amazon, a global ecommerce leader, has a wide collection of integrations that provide developers with the access to Amazon’s functionality and data through its backend services. Implementing these APIs provides your customers with the best-in-class experience.
Whether you are looking for an API that will provide real-time Amazon product prices, review details or updated product data, Amazon’s integrations can be helpful.
When it comes to ecommerce APIs, eBay is currently ruling in many parts of the world as it has plenty of APIs.
eBay API helps in managing multiple features like searching, buying, or selling any goods over the platform and supports several formats including JSON, XML, HTML, and plain text.
Regardless of the functionality for which you are looking for an API, you can go for eBay as it has an extensive suite of functionalities.
5. Google Content API for Shopping
The Google Content API helps in managing your shopping items programmatically. For example, you have an account with Google Merchant Center. Herein, the API would allow you to upload products, control your inventory, link products on Google Ads, control Google Merchant Center accounts, and even navigate orders and returns.
So, if you are looking for ways to simplify the processes of running an online store, Google Content API for shopping can provide numerous solutions.
Ecommerce APIs are empowering the success of online businesses
Owning and running an online store is challenging, but the right set of ecommerce APIs can make it easy for you and help you take your business to the next level. Whether you are just starting your ecommerce business, or have already established one, API integrations listed above can help you improve functionality and user experience, enhance security, reduce obstacles to innovation and improve automation processes, helping you achieve new milestones.